Description
Introduced in 1890, through the efforts of 1st Lieutenant Edward Casey of the 22nd US Infantry. Casey at that time commanded a company of North Cheyenne mounted scouts stationed at Fort Keogh Montana. This pattern helmet, is the only US Army M1881 dress helmet of the era to feature multiple colors in its plume and cording, with the ends of the plume extending 6-8 inches below the edge of the helmet. The helmet is complete with all proper insignia, fittings, original wool cords / waffles and leather chin strap. The underside of the leather sweatband is Horstmann marked with an 1898 contract date.
